How much do intern new grad software engineer j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 22, 2026, the average hourly pay for intern new grad software engineer in Racine, WI is $23.83,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.38 and $27.07 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Software Engineer II

Position Description: Performs a variety of moderately complex engineering duties to design, plan, and oversee the architect, design, development, and management of software systems applied to new or existing products. Evaluates progress and results of projects. Recommends changes in design, procedures or objectives as necessary.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Develops and manages control system software for various power systems at the given partially developed requirements
  • Uses MATLAB/Simulink and/or C programming to create embedded control software
  • Deploys control algorithms to embedded controllers (rapid prototyping and production ECU)
  • Creates moderately complex software requirements, specifications and validation plans given system level definition of functional requirements.
  • Develops engineering test standards
  • Acts as a liaison between other departments as necessary
  • Maintains software portfolio; - revision control, release, obsolescence and maintenance
  • Performs other duties as assigned

Job Skills Requirements:

  • Experience in object-oriented design and analysis using C++ and MATLAB
  • Familiarity with control development and calibration tools including dSpace, Vector CANalyzer, ETAS INCA, and ATI Vision
  • Knowledge of appropriate standards and regulations
  • Experience with software management tools including Subversion and Git
  • Ability to work well with others as part of a diverse global team
  • Well developed communication skills to explain designs and logic used
  • Fluent in English and primary language used in area of responsibility and/or location

Education: Bachelor's Degree in Engineering or Related field

Experience Requirements: Three years of professional engineering experience

Physical & Environmental Requirements: Briggs & Stratton, headquartered in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, provides innovative products and diverse power solutions to help people get work done. Briggs & Stratton is the world's largest producer of engines for outdoor power equipment, and is a leading designer, manufacturer and marketer of lithium-ion battery, standby generator, energy storage system, lawn and turf care products through its Briggs & Stratton®, Vanguard®, Ferris®, Billy Goat®, and Branco® brands. Briggs & Stratton products are designed, manufactured, marketed and serviced in more than 100 countries on six continents. Briggs & Stratton is committed to a policy of equal employment opportunity.
